GOV ZULUM VISITS MINISTERS, UNDP, TCN, etc.

By Dauda R Pam
 Borno State Governor, Babagana Umara Zulum, has  held  six (6) separate meetings in his recent visit to Abuja with the United Nations DEVELOPMENT programme, UNDP, Development bank of Nigeria, DBN, and transmission company of Nigeria,TCN, among others, to  strategize on modalities aimed at facilitating development in the state.
The Governor’s  visit was hinged on discussing developmental initiatives to attract investments as well as identify areas hindering rapid Development in Borno, particularly the small and medium entrepreneurship  strides.
To that effect, Prof.Zulum, was at Development Bank of Nigeria (DBN) which was conceived by the Federal Government of Nigeria (FGN) in collaboration with global development partners to address the major financing challenges facing Micro, Small and Medium Scale Enterprises (MSMEs) in Nigeria,from where he proceeded to hold meeting with Minister of Power, Engineer Saleh Mamman and  the Transmission Company Of Nigeria (TCN), largely to facilitate improved power supply to Borno state.
In the same vein, he was at the Federal ministry of Works and Housing and met with the substantive minister Babatunde Raji Fashola as well as the state minister Engr. Abubakar D. Aliyu, where he followed up on various federal projects ongoing in Borno State, particularly the rehabilitation of major federal roads including Maiduguri — Bama/Banki road, Biu — Gombe road, Maiduguri — Ngala roads among others.
